Vertex Launches Technically Advanced Mobile Jaw Crusher for Global Operations

Vertex Bergbaumaschinen has launched a new mobile jaw crusher featuring advanced hydraulics, dual power control, and heavy-duty crawler systems, designed for efficient, emission-compliant performance in global quarrying and mining operations.
- (1888PressRelease) May 14, 2025 - Vertex Bergbaumaschinen today announced the official launch of its latest generation mobile jaw crusher, featuring a series of engineering upgrades aimed at improving performance, reliability, and field adaptability for quarrying, mining, and construction operations worldwide.
At the core of the machine is a 7m³ capacity receiving hopper equipped with hydraulic folding, automatic frequency conversion feeding, and a durable steel plate welding structure. The vibrating feeder includes a complete pre-screening system with manual control options, offering increased flexibility during operation.
The crushing system is powered by a Volvo engine combined with a Stanford generator. High-performance hydraulic functionality is supported by German-imported Rexroth plunger pumps and proportional valves, ensuring consistent output under heavy-duty conditions. These components comply with National III emission standards, highlighting Vertex’s commitment to sustainable equipment development.
To ensure operational control and safety, the machine is equipped with an advanced electric control cabinet. It supports frequency conversion start and proportional regulation, and includes both wireless and wired remote control options. An ABB dual power switch system allows seamless transitions between power sources, with the cabinet offering IP55-rated protection against dust and vibration.
A significant structural upgrade is evident in the crawler system. The assembled heavy-duty undercarriage—imported from the UK—provides a load capacity of up to 52 tons. The “soft start” double-speed crawler ensures low deviation and stable mobility, even on uneven or inclined terrain. The robust frame uses a thick load-bearing structure with reinforced flange joints to ensure longevity under continuous strain.
Additional functional components include a 1000mm wide finished product conveyor with segmented folding and a discharge height of 3.4 meters. The integrated iron separation device features an 800mm band, permanent magnet self-unloading type, and standard belt armor, offering effective metal removal during processing. A symmetrical galvanized walkway design improves accessibility for maintenance and inspection on both sides of the machine.
Despite its heavy-duty capabilities, the machine maintains transport efficiency with a footprint of 17.3 meters in length, 5.8 meters in width, and a height of 4.5 meters. Its compact design ensures compliance with global transportation standards while delivering industrial-level capacity in the field.
